Title:
  Need to force alsa to reload after reboot to have sound

Status in alsa-driver package in Ubuntu:
  New

Bug description:
  Hello,
  I just installed ubuntu 20.04.01 (Focal Fossa) from a 18.04 version.

  I need to reload at each reboot alsa with:

  sudo alsa force-reload

  The workaround proposed here work for me.
  https://askubuntu.com/a/1281216/772996

  alsa seems to kill timidity (?)

  This solves it:
  systemctl disable timidity
